Taxonomic Classification

Rank Halmaheran Blossom Bat Lygaeid bug
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Arthropoda (Arthropods)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Insecta (Insects)
Order Chiroptera (Bats) Hemiptera (Hemiptera)
Family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ats) Lygaeidae
Genus Syconycteris Nysius
Species Syconycteris carolinae Nysius thymi

Evolutionary Relationship

Halmaheran Blossom Bat and Lygaeid bug share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
